So we've developed our own RWA sector page
where we have many vaults.
Each of them is dedicated to one specific RWA product.
And right now we just concluded the first vault on the ConfLux chain,
which was done through, thanks to assets from Ant Digital,
which is a giant tech company in China.
And we just finished a three-month period of the vault
where we reached a cap of 200,000 USDT deposits.
And this collateral managed to give depositors a yield of 8% APY.
And now, this is the news of just today,
we are renewing this vault.
We're actually doing double down.
So if the cap was previously of 200,000 USDT,
now we're opening a new vault
with the same collateral backed by AND Digital.
But this time the cap is
300 000 usdt and last time it was uh filled in less than two days uh so you know hopefully this
time it will be around three days but you still have time so how does it work the vault uh the
first vault finishes uh this midnight utc uh from that moment, you will have seven weeks
to withdraw the money from the previous vault
and deposit it in the new vault.
And the new vault will start generating yield in a week from now.
So on 23rd September midnight UTC.
And again, it will be another three months locked vault
with 8% APY
granted on top of
4D collateral, which is the
RWA asset provided by Ndigital.

Yeah, so just to clarify on that,
so there's,
obviously Conflux is the blockchain where the vault is.
Conflux is also the creator of the market.
And Digital is this massive data infrastructure company, extremely popular in China.
And this is where the battery cabinets which supply for the RWA come from. And then we have Victor Securities, which is a licensed tokenization
and custody company, which tokenized N-Digital's technologies
battery swapping infrastructure and made a token out of it.
So users can deposit USDT that can be used,
can be borrowed by the market creator.
And in exchange, they can get an 8% APY
and the collateral is tokenized,
but as well from digital technologies.
